How they compare
Bulgaria currently reports 11,065 1000 SLC against 9,382 1000 SLC in Croatia, a difference of 1,683 1000 SLC.
That makes Bulgaria's figure about 1.2 times Croatia's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 20 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Bulgaria ahead.
Bulgaria ranks 45th and Croatia ranks 48th of 66 countries.
Bulgaria has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bulgaria | Croatia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 27,398 1000 SLC | 7,753 1000 SLC | 19,645 1000 SLC | Bulgaria |
| 2000s | 19,095 1000 SLC | 8,702 1000 SLC | 10,393 1000 SLC | Bulgaria |
| 2010s | 10,834 1000 SLC | 9,563 1000 SLC | 1,271 1000 SLC | Bulgaria |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
